Sajero is a lightweight management app for apartment and condominium property administrators. The available text indicates that it originated from the Alejandrina apartment building in the Escandón neighborhood of Mexico City. Its goal is straightforward: to help administrators handle day-to-day tasks such as resident communication, distribution of accounting documents, electronic receipts, and voting.
Based on the disclosed information, Sajero’s core modules include: administrators publishing announcements to residents; residents posting content for neighbors, with support for comments and file attachments; administrators uploading account statements for residents to download; residents downloading electronic receipts after administrators confirm payments; and launching voting processes. Overall, it is more focused on internal community operations and basic property-management coordination than on being a full property ERP or financial system.

The text only clearly identifies two types of users: administrators and residents. Administrators are responsible for announcements, uploading statements, and confirming payments, while residents download documents, publish community content, and participate in interactions. Its strengths are a focused use case and simple functionality, covering common needs in small apartment management such as communication, accounting documents, and voting. Residents can download materials on their own, which can reduce repeated file-sending work for administrators. The downside is that public information is very limited: there are no clear details on pricing, service support, security and compliance, or integration capabilities. Support appears to be limited to a contact email, so maturity and scalability should be evaluated carefully. Sajero is better suited to small apartment buildings, community administrators, or homeowners’ committees that need basic digital communication. It is less suitable for property-management companies with higher requirements around permissions, auditing, financial integrations, and SLAs.
